Social Security payments are changing in 2026 — here’s how your monthly check could shift

Social Security benefits will increase by 2.8% in 2026 to help 75 million Americans fight inflation. This Cost-of-Living Adjustment (COLA) boosts monthly checks for retirees, disabled workers, and SSI recipients. Most beneficiaries will see higher payments starting in January. However, SSI recipients get their first raise on December 31, 2025, due to the New Year’s Day holiday.
